A BILL
To prohibit the Secretary of Homeland Security, or any other person,
from requiring repayment, recoupment, or offset of certain antidumping
duties and countervailing duties paid under section 754 of the Tariff
Act of 1930,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Domestic Reinvestment Act of 2022''.
SEC. 2. TERMINATION OF ALL EFFORTS TO CLAWBACK PAYMENTS OF CERTAIN
ANTIDUMPING DUTIES AND COUNTERVAILING DUTIES.
(a) In General.--Notwithstanding any other provision of law,
neither the Secretary of Homeland Security nor any other person may--
(1) require repayment of, or attempt in any other way to
recoup, any payment described in subsection (b); or
(2) offset any past, current, or future distributions of
antidumping duties or countervailing duties assessed on any
imports in an attempt to recoup any payment described in
subsection (b).
(b) Payments Described.--Payments described in this subsection are
payments of antidumping duties or countervailing duties made pursuant
to section 754 of the Tariff Act of 1930 (19 U.S.C. 1675c (repealed by
subtitle F of title VII of the Deficit Reduction Act of 2005 (Public
Law 109-171; 120 Stat. 154))) that were--
(1) assessed and paid with respect to imports of goods from
any country; and
(2) distributed on or after January 1, 2001.
(c) Payment of Funds Collected or Withheld.--Not later than 90 days
after the date of the enactment of this Act, the Secretary of Homeland
Security shall--
(1) refund any repayment or other recoupment of any payment
described in subsection (b); and
(2) fully distribute any antidumping duties or
countervailing duties that the Commissioner of U.S. Customs and
Border Protection is withholding as an offset as described in
subsection (a)(2).
(d) Limitation.--Nothing in this section shall be construed to
prevent the Secretary of Homeland Security, or any other person, from
requiring repayment of, or attempting to otherwise recoup, any payment
described in subsection (b) as a result of--
(1) a finding of false statements, other misconduct, or
insufficient verification of a certification by a recipient of
such a payment; or
(2) the issuance of a refund to an importer or surety
pursuant to a settlement, court order, or reliquidation of an
entry with respect to which such a payment was made.
